No fines for COVID-19 vaccine refusal, WA Health Minister confirms

West Australians will not be fined for refusing a COVID-19 vaccine, the state’s Health Minister Roger Cook says.
Key points:
- Workers and vulnerable patients will be prioritised for the Pfizer vaccine
- West Australians are unlikely to be forced to accept a vaccine
- The rollout is expected to be especially challenging in northern areas
The WA Government is working with the Commonwealth to implement a rollout of a COVID-19 vaccine as early as next month.
Mr Cook said there would be a requirement for people working in certain areas to be vaccinated.
